What is an ASP.NET Core Developer?
ASP.NET Core developers build web applications and APIs using Microsoft's modern, cross-platform framework. They leverage C# and the .NET ecosystem to create high-performance, scalable backend systems for enterprises and startups alike.
As an ASP.NET Core developer, you will design RESTful APIs, implement authentication systems, work with databases using Entity Framework, and deploy applications to Azure or other cloud platforms.
Key Responsibilities
- Build RESTful APIs and web applications
- Implement authentication and authorization
- Design database schemas with Entity Framework
- Write unit and integration tests
- Implement clean architecture patterns
- Deploy to Azure and manage CI/CD
- Optimize application performance
